Pyramid View 9th floor Balcony

Here you can relax in a quiet environment but still have access to the main attractions of this Area, The Pyramids and the Sphinx are literally on your doorstep. A short distance you can visit the Step Pyramid at Sakarra & Memphis.

There are many places to visit in Cairo itself, i.e. the Famous Museum, see the The Pharonic Village (like going back in time), The Citadel (home to Egypt Rulers for some 700 years), visit the Mohammed Ali Mosque, this is a work of art and took 18 years to build.

Don't miss a visit to the famous 14th century Khan el Kalili Market. Take an evening cruise down the River Nile and enjoy the entertainment and music.

Where is Pyramid View 9th floor Balcony located?

Located in Al Haram, this apartment building is 0.8 mi (1.3 km) from Keops Pyramid and 1.3 mi (2 km) from Giza Pyramid Complex. Giza Plateau and Sound and Light Theater are also within 2 mi (3 km).

10/10 Excellent

Steve A., Long Beach, California

The most helpful hosts in the world! Perfect for travelers new to Egypt
A comfortable, spacious, safe home away from home for our group of ten ... and so much more! The U.S. based hosts introduced us to an outstanding tour operator they work with all the time, Ashraef, He and his brother arranged all our visits to historic sites and fun activities for our teenagers. Their suggestions led us to activities we would have never considered. The guide connected well with group members aged 15-65. And we paid a fraction of the price charged by other well-rated guide services. (About $150/day for guide and large van, compared with $600/day from operators who charge by the head) The apartment itself was spacious, comfortable, with a well-equipped full kitchen and two full size baths. And a view of the Giza Pyramid. The neighborhood looked (and truly is) chaotic, but proved safe at all hours and was convenient to shopping and restaurants. The owner's sister lives very close and was available to quickly step into action when we faced the usual local problems; internet breakdowns and loss of water pressure. These are unavoidable issues in one of the world's largest and most chaotic cities, and we were fortunate to have a host who knew who to call to get problems solved in hours, not days. When we had an emergency with misplaced passports on a trip to the red sea, the hosts went into the unit at our request, found the passports and had them messengered to us. In short, this apartment comes with a complete travel support system.

8/10 Good

Wynn T., Florida

Great apartment, but watch the tour guide
This apartment was the most luxurious of all the VRBO apartments that we stayed in. Four to six adults could live here easily and well. The view from the patio of the great pyramid were spectacular, and you can see the roof tops across the street with goats and chickens for a little local culture. A few glitches were handled swiftly on the first night by the manager, Sayed, and the owner, Vern, called to check and see if everything was OK. The internet is handled through a 3G card, a little slow, but it is portable. The downside was that the owner recommended the manager to handle the tours. We found the managers tours to be unprofessional. There was nothing in writing (but I had notes). There was at least one element missing from each tour, the prices increased as we went along, and there were several harassing phone calls the last night to get every last Egyptian pound I had. Remember that in Egypt, "caveat emptor" is alive and well, all the pyramids are not made of stone, and no gift is free. I recommend you check some other tours, like Viator.com or habibitours.com before making any final commitments. Overall, it was an excellent accomodation, and a good trip, with the lone exception of how the tours were handled that brought the "overall experience at the property" down a notch.
